Phoenix Conservatory of Music Promotes Emergency Relocating & Reopening Fund
By Lisa Padilla - Thursday Sep 17, 2020
Phoenix Conservatory of Music (PCM) announces today its Emergency Relocating & Reopening Fund, Go Fund Me page has only raised one-third the amount necessary to fund its move to a new facility.

Willing donors are asked to help fund the move by going to the PCM Go Fund Me page. PCM would like to remind donors it is a 501(c)3 organization and donations are 100 percent tax deductible.

Nearly 700 students and 30 teachers were recently displaced due to the permanent closing of Metrocenter Mall in late June. PCM learned of the closure that month after using the space for its school and music studios since 2011.

At present, PCM is functioning virtually due to the COVID-19 pandemic, so operationally it can continue to serve its students. The school plans to return to normal in-person operations as soon as it is safe to do so.
